> [IPSEC]: Use IPv6 calling convention as the convention for x->mode->output
> 
> The IPv6 calling convention for x->mode->output is more general and could
> help an eventual protocol-generic x->type->output implementation.  This
> patch adopts it for IPv4 as well and modifies the IPv4 type output functions
> accordingly.
> 
> It also rewrites the IPv6 mac/transport header calculation to be based off
> the network header where practical.
